Heroku now offers beta support for OpenJDK 7, as well as an updated version of OpenJDK 6. Support for both JDKs are available in a new buildpack. OpenJDK 6 is still the default, but the version has been increased to u25 from u20 -- changes for u20-u25 can be found on Oracle's changelist blog. OpenJDK 7 can be enabled by configuring your pom.xml
. Currently, only maven builds are supported with this update.
This update has no impact on any running applications. If you choose not to use this buildpack, your applications will continue to use OpenJDK 6u20.
